When the LORD restored the fortunes of Zion,

we were like those who dreamed.

Our mouths were filled with laughter,

our tongues with songs of joy.

Then it was said among the nations,

“The LORD has done great things for them.”

The LORD has done great things for us,

and we are filled with joy.

Restore our fortunes, LORD,

like streams in the Negev.

Those who sow with tears

will reap with songs of joy.

Those who go out weeping,

carrying seed to sow,

will return with songs of joy,

carrying sheaves with them.

- Psalm 126

 

This week, Pastor Jason Cheung from Tapestry Marpole visits us to explore Psalm 126, how it spoke to him during the pandemic about the meaning of sowing tears and how it relates to the nature of joy.
